Intellectual Property Rights in Industry

Intellectual Property Rights (IPR) in industry refer to the legal protections for creations of the mind, like inventions, designs, and brands. These rights help businesses secure their innovations, preventing others from copying or using them without permission. In the context of international industrial economics, IPR affects global competition and trade, as companies seek to protect their competitive edge while navigating different legal systems. Strong IPR can encourage investment in research and development, ultimately fostering innovation and economic growth on a global scale.
